Birchanger Green Roundabout is junction 8 of the M11. Originally just the access for Bishop's Stortford, it became more important with the development of Stansted Airport. To deal with the traffic, in the '90s cut-through was added to the roundabout and then in the '00s, free-flowing slip roads bypassing the whole junction were created.

Originally the A1250 from Bishop's stortford also joined the roundabout; however, with the building of Birchanger Green services, the A1250 was diverted to meet the A120 at a new roundabout to the west of Birchanger Green, and a short piece of dual carriageway constructed to link the two roundabouts. Concern at the time in parliament was principally around siting the services and Stansted so close together, and that the in-fill between Bishop's Stortford and Stansted by adding a motorway service area would encourage further development - Hansard May 1987

In 2014, proposals emerged for possible future enhancements to the interchange, to support further growth in the area; these were:

  • 1. Amended lane markings and new filter lane between M11 s/b and Stansted airport
  • 2. Option 1 plus additional lane marking changes to M11 n/b offslip
  • 3. Option 2 plus additional lane on M11 n/b offslip
  • 5. Option 3 plus additional lanes on both A120 approaches

The report then goes on to say that further improvements to the interchange could only be achieved by providing dedicated M11 north facing sliproads for Stansted airport plus grade separation of the A120 route, perhaps by provision of a flyover above the interchange. (source: Uttlesford District Council)

In 2018, Essex County Council provided detailed plans for improvements to the junction, including the addition of further stacking lanes on the approaches to the roundabout, and the replacement of the A120/A1250 satellite roundabout with a signalised crossroads as a "short to medium term" solution, with preliminary works expected to commence in winter 2018 and work being complete two years later.
